charset="utf-8" From: Stefan Hajnoczi There is no need for aio_context_use_g_source() now that epoll(7) and io_uring(7) file descriptor monitoring works with the glib event loop. AioContext doesn't need to be notified that GSource is being used. On hosts with io_uring support this now enables fdmon-io_uring.c by default, replacing fdmon-poll.c and fdmon-epoll.c. In other words, the event loop will use io_uring!
